Output 54d574b0403537a65027ca5bef20b6754a1288c1dff52d74fee97936c55acd58:0

value
40505426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e13137245cb93012ca7a50c0279f28f52a6117f4 OP_EQUAL
address
3NDivFY6qonGR4vApTBiRB8ino5RUDKiyF
transaction
54d574b0403537a65027ca5bef20b6754a1288c1dff52d74fee97936c55acd58
confirmations
314419
spent
true